免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

青岛做app开发

青岛是一座美丽的海滨城市,也是中国著名的科技城市之一。在这里,有很多优秀的开发者,他们致力于研发各种各样的应用程序。如果你想在青岛开发一款自己的应用程序,下面是一些关于如何做app开发的原理和详细介绍。

一、确定应用程序的类型和目标用户

在开始开发应用程序之前,你需要确定应用程序的类型和目标用户。这将帮助你了解你的应用程序需要具备哪些功能和特性,以及如何设计用户界面。你需要考虑以下几个问题:

1. 应用程序的类型:是游戏、社交、商务、工具还是其他类型?

2. 目标用户:是年轻人、中年人、老年人、男性、女性还是其他人群?

3. 应用程序的功能和特性:需要具备哪些基本功能和特性?如何设计用户界面?

二、确定应用程序的平台和开发工具

在确定应用程序的类型和目标用户之后,你需要确定应用程序的平台和开发工具。目前,主要的应用程序平台包括iOS、Android和Windows Phone。每个平台都有自己的特点和开发工具。你需要根据你的应用程序类型和目标用户来选择适合的平台和开发工具。

1. iOS平台:iOS是苹果公司的移动操作系统,它的开发工具是Xcode。Xcode是一款功能强大的集成开发环境(IDE),可以用来开发iOS应用程序。Xcode支持Objective-C和Swift编程语言。

2. Android平台:Android是谷歌公司的移动操作系统,它的开发工具是Android Studio。Android Studio是一款基于IntelliJ IDEA的集成开发环境(IDE),可以用来开发Android应用程序。Android应用程序可以使用Java或Kotlin编程语言。

3. Windows Phone平台:Windows Phone是微软公司的移动操作系统,它的开发工具是Visual Studio。Visual Studio是一款功能强大的集成开发环境(IDE),可以用来开发Windows Phone应用程序。Windows Phone应用程序可以使用C#或VB.NET编程语言。

三、设计应用程序的界面和功能

在确定应用程序的平台和开发工具之后,你需要设计应用程序的界面和功能。这是应用程序开发的关键步骤之一。你需要考虑以下几个问题:

1. 应用程序的用户界面:如何设计用户界面,使得用户可以轻松地使用应用程序?

2. 应用程序的功能和特性:应用程序需要具备哪些基本功能和特性?

3. 应用程序的数据结构和算法:应用程序需要使用哪些数据结构和算法来实现功能?

四、编写应用程序的代码

在设计应用程序的界面和功能之后,你需要编写应用程序的代码。这是应用程序开发的核心步骤之一。你需要使用你所选择的开发工具来编写代码,并使用适当的编程语言来实现应用程序的功能。你需要注意以下几个问题:

1. 编写清晰、简洁、可维护的代码:你需要编写清晰、简洁、可维护的代码,以便于其他开发者能够理解和修改你的代码。

2. 使用适当的编程语言和框架:你需要使用适当的编程语言和框架来实现应用程序的功能。

3. 进行适当的测试和调试:在编写代码的过程中,你需要进行适当的测试和调试,以确保应用程序能够正常运行。

五、发布应用程序

在编写应用程序的代码之后,你需要发布应用程序。发布应用程序的过程包括以下几个步骤:

1. 注册开发者账号:你需要注册开发者账号,以便于在应用商店中发布应用程序。

2. 提交应用程序:你需要将应用程序提交到相应的应用商店中进行审核和发布。

3. 进行推广和营销:你需要进行适当的推广和营销,以吸引用户下载和使用你的应用程序。

总之,青岛是一个非常适合开发应用程序的城市。如果你想在青岛做app开发,你需要确定应用程序的类型和目标用户,选择适合的平台和开发工具,设计应用程序的界面和功能,编写应用程序的代码,并最终发布应用程序。


相关知识:
app开发语言是什么
APP开发语言是指用于开发移动应用程序的编程语言。随着移动设备的普及和移动应用的快速发展,各种编程语言也应运而生,用于满足不同平台和需求的开发。目前,主要的APP开发语言包括Java、Swift、Objective-C和Kotlin等。下面将对这些语言进行
2023-06-29
app开发的技术分析
APP开发技术在现代移动应用开发中扮演着至关重要的角色。APP开发技术可分为本地APP开发和跨平台APP开发两种类型。其中本地APP开发指针对特定操作系统(例如苹果iOS或安卓)进行的单独应用,而跨平台APP开发允许开发人员创建同时适用于多种操作系统的单个
2023-06-29
app开发的三大技术框架
随着移动互联网的迅猛发展,应用开发成为众多IT公司争相布局的重要领域。在这个领域,无论是开发高效、可靠的移动应用,还是为不同平台提供更好的应用体验都是比较困难的。为了解决这些难题,开发人员采用了不同的技术框架。本文将介绍app开发的三大技术框架:React
2023-06-29
app开发方共犯
随着智能手机和移动应用的普及,APP开发越来越成为了一个热门领域。然而,APP开发并不总是顺利的,许多人经验不足或者缺少规划,导致他们在应用程序开发中犯下一些常见的错误。这些错误称为“APP开发方共犯”。下面我们就来详细介绍一下APP开发方共犯的原理和内容
2023-06-29
app开发公司时应避免的错误
在网络时代,移动应用(APP)已经成为人们生活中必不可少的一部分。伴随着APP市场的火爆,越来越多的企业和个人加入到APP开发领域,但是在APP开发过程中很容易犯一些错误。本文将介绍APP开发公司应该避免的一些错误。1. 不充分了解客户需求APP开发是一项
2023-06-29
app功能开发思维导图
APP功能开发思维导图是一种简单而有用的思维框架,用于辅助APP开发人员进行开发过程中的规划与安排。以下是APP功能开发思维导图的原理和详细介绍。一、原理APP功能开发思维导图是一种由APP开发人员根据需求,在脑海中预先构建出整个APP功能结构,并将其视觉
2023-05-06